two. Vacuum Coating Technological innovation

Vacuum coating technologies consists of making use of a thin film to some substrate in a vacuum setting. This process makes certain large-quality, uniform coatings with great adhesion Attributes.

Important Tactics:
Actual physical Vapor Deposition (PVD): Involves the physical transfer of fabric from the resource for the substrate.
Chemical Vapor Deposition (CVD): Will involve chemical reactions to deposit a strong content to the substrate.
Magnetron Sputtering: A variety of PVD exactly where a goal content is bombarded with ions, producing it to sputter and coat the substrate.

five. Vacuum Coating Procedure

The vacuum coating process ordinarily entails several ways:

Preparing: Cleansing and making ready the substrate.
Loading: Placing the substrate within the vacuum chamber.
Evacuation: Eradicating air to create a vacuum.
Coating: Making use of The skinny film working with strategies like PVD or CVD.
Cooling and Unloading: Permitting the coated Vacuum Coating Process substrate to chill just before removing.
